Alleged Rape & Murder of Young Woman in Safapora Triggers Widespread Outrage

SSP Ganderbal Visits Protest Site, Says “This Is About Justice,” Assures Action in Murder Case

Gadyal Desk by Gadyal Desk
14/07/2025
A A
FacebookTwitterWhatsappTelegram

Ganderbal, July 14 (JKNS): A young woman’s mysterious death in the Safapora area of central Kashmir’s Ganderbal district has triggered massive protests after reports emerged suggesting she may have been raped and murdered.

Locals, civil society members, and traders took to the streets, demanding immediate justice and stringent punishment for the accused.

According to locals, the woman was found dead at her in-laws’ residence. Initially believed to be a case of natural death, the situation took a serious turn after Safapora Police insisted on conducting a postmortem.

“One of the locals, as per news agency JKNS, said, ‘We assembled immediately when we heard something had happened to her. We rushed to her in-laws’ home and found her dead. Safapora and Ganderbal Police both suggested a postmortem, but we didn’t agree at first, thinking it was a natural death. However, Safapora Police insisted and said it must be done. After the postmortem report came, it became clear this wasn’t an accident but a murder. We’re now protesting to demand justice. The killer must be arrested and punished.’”

Another protester said, “We came to offer condolences, and at first, we were told it was an accident. But later, hospital reports revealed it was not a natural death. We were shocked to know it was a murder. Today, we are protesting as one. The entire trade community is here. The market is closed. This is the first such incident in Safapora, and we are at a loss for words. What we’re hearing about this case is horrifying. It’s the height of brutality.”

The protests intensified, with slogans of “Katiloon Ko Phansi Do” echoing through the area. In response, SSP Ganderbal, Khalil Ahmad Poswal, visited Safapora to address the protesters directly.

Speaking to the crowd, as per JKNS, SSP Poswal said, “A forensics team was immediately called. All samples have been collected and sent to the lab. I just need your cooperation anyone who saw something or has evidence should come to us and record their statement. I was called yesterday and told to avoid the postmortem, but I said no there will be a postmortem, and action will follow. This case is being treated as murder, and I guarantee a formal arrest will happen. There will be no bail. Anyone found aiding the accused will also be booked. This is not about me; this is about justice.”

He further added, “Please make a team of four responsible members who will stay in touch with the police. If at any point you feel the investigation isn’t being done fairly, you can come to me directly. This is not just a law-and-order issue it’s about a fair investigation.”

As of now, the police have yet to officially name any suspects. However, SSP Poswal’s on-ground assurance and the growing public outrage have intensified pressure on law enforcement agencies to act swiftly.

The incident has deeply shocked the community, with many calling it a dark and disturbing first in the area’s history. The public has vowed to continue protests until justice is delivered. (JKNS)
